Are these problems primarily on early z's?
 
Like the title says, are these problems listed in this forum lostly low vin/early cars? I was dead set on buying a z in about three months, but if these problems are persisting on cars produced now, then I am going to have to rethink tht plan :(

MannishBoy Apr 2, 2003 04:08 PM

You need to tell us what problems you are referring too.

You also have to realize that problems are much more visible than happy people. When you read these forums, you tend to get a slanted view, because you only see the problem posts.

My car has nothing I'd consider serious wrong with it in 3500 miles. The only thing I've really had to gripe about was the bounce on some roads that is just the way the suspension was designed. I have kind of a light vibration issue that may be a tire balance thing, but I haven't figured it out yet.

polar Apr 2, 2003 06:26 PM

Mainly referring to the tire "feathering" issue and transmision issues (i.e. grinding gears) - other issues are not tht big of a deal (the paint chipping i think is due to new formulation of water based paints and is not 350z specific).

I realize that this area of the forum is sample biased, and was hoping to hear from members that had recently acquired their cars and hearing if they had any of the issues described above. The only thing about recent cars is that they might not have had the time to see if there is unusual tire wear and whatnot.
